summaryrefslogtreecommitdiffstats
path: root/etc/inc
diff options
context:
space:
mode:
authorScott Ullrich <sullrich@pfsense.org>2006-10-08 20:40:58 +0000
committerScott Ullrich <sullrich@pfsense.org>2006-10-08 20:40:58 +0000
commit659299496178087ee4da20d043835c5e64be6cdc (patch)
treee65f56f7c4a0d665c3633dcf01fb6cca305ab5e7 /etc/inc
parent28f9e493b9ebd28db31cb8c6a21d0ed5adbe5518 (diff)
downloadpfsense-659299496178087ee4da20d043835c5e64be6cdc.zip
pfsense-659299496178087ee4da20d043835c5e64be6cdc.tar.gz
Show a *BIG FAT WARNING* that under 128 megaytes does not work during initial setup if <128 megs of ram detected.
Diffstat (limited to 'etc/inc')
-rw-r--r--etc/inc/config.inc13
1 files changed, 13 insertions, 0 deletions
diff --git a/etc/inc/config.inc b/etc/inc/config.inc
index 696ae13..21b991e 100644
--- a/etc/inc/config.inc
+++ b/etc/inc/config.inc
@@ -1046,6 +1046,19 @@ function set_networking_interfaces_ports() {
$fp = fopen('php://stdin', 'r');
+ $memory = get_memory();
+ $avail = $memory[0];
+
+ if($avail < 128) {
+ echo "\n\n\n";
+ echo "DANGER! WARNING!\n\n";
+ echo "pfSense requires *ATLEAST* 128 megs of ram to function correctly.\n";
+ echo "Only ($avail) megs of ram has been detected.";
+ echo "\nPress ENTER to continue.";
+ fgets($fp);
+ echo "\n";
+ }
+
$iflist = get_interface_list();
echo <<<EOD
OpenPOWER on IntegriCloud